In January, John Guidetti came to Hannover 96 on loan from the La Liga team Alavés. In total there were 17 games and three goals for the national striker. But more matches in the club will not be when John Guidetti said hello to the club's fans on their Youtube channel.

- Hi all fans. I just want to say thank you from the depth of my heart for the time at the club. We have not met as many times in the arena as I would have liked because of the things that have happened in the world. But the time we shared was special, and I want to say thank you to all the supporters and everyone around the club with players and coaches. Thanks for being here, it's been a wonderful time, he says.

Swedish-Chilean Miiko Albornoz, who has been a member of the club since 2014, also leaves Hannover 96.
